House Carpenter Helper Job Description

Job Brief

As a House Carpenter Helper, you will play a vital support role in residential construction projects. This entry-level position involves assisting skilled carpenters by performing tasks that require less specialized skills, such as handling materials, maintaining tools, and ensuring a clean and safe work environment. Ideal candidates will possess basic knowledge of carpentry tools and techniques, demonstrating an eagerness to learn and develop their skills in the construction industry.

Responsibilities

  • Assist carpenters in various carpentry tasks, including framing, roofing, and cabinetry.
  • Supply, hold, and clean tools and materials as directed by lead carpenters.
  • Maintain a safe and organized work area by cleaning debris and managing equipment.
  • Transport materials and tools to job sites, ensuring efficient workflow.
  • Follow safety protocols to minimize risks and injuries on the job site.
  • Participate in training sessions to enhance skills and knowledge in carpentry techniques.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ent preferred.
  • Basic knowledge of carpentry tools and materials is a plus.
  • Ability to follow instructions and work effectively as part of a team.
  • Strong physical stamina and ability to lift heavy materials.
  • Good communication skills and a willingness to learn from experienced carpenters.
  • Familiarity with safety practices in the construction industry.
